The 1969 Texas vs. Arkansas football game, sometimes referred to as the "Game of the Century", was a college football game played on December 6 in which No. 1 Texas visited No. 2 Arkansas at Razorback Stadium in Fayetteville, Arkansas. The Longhorns came back from a 14–0 deficit after three quarters to win 15–14. On New Year's Day 1970 they won the Cotton Bowl Classic 21–17 over Notre Dame with a late touchdown drive and were selected as national champions.
